NIAR/NCAT to Host FAA-sponsored Composites Maintenance and Repair Course Online

Feb. 10, 2010
An online Composites Maintenance Technology course that will focus on critical composite materials maintenance and repair safety issues begins March 1.

Wichita State University’s National Institute for Aviation Research (NIAR) and Wichita Area Technical College through the new National Center for Aviation Training (NCAT) will host an on-line Composites Maintenance Technology course that will focus on critical composite materials maintenance and repair safety issues beginning March 1. There are two enrollment options for the course:

• Intro to Composites Maintenance Technology online course (non-credit) $950

• Intro to Composites Maintenance Technology online course (2 credit hours - WATC) $1,174

The dates and enrollment for an optional three-day Composite Maintenance Technology lab will be available at the close of the online course.
